It’s about time Bowerbirds paid a visit to Denton. Bowerbirds’ organic rhythms — not to be confused with crude strumming, but rather subtle arrangements and raw energy, easily surpass those of Devendra Banhart or Beirut
Inspiration must come easy for founding members, Phil Moore and Beth Tacular, through living off the power grid in an Airstream in the North Carolina woods. Most of their songs connect to the tensions and relationships of man to nature and men to women.
